The Power of Renewable Energy Sources

The Power of Renewable Energy Sources

Renewable sources of energy are revolutionizing the way we power our world. Unlike traditional fossil fuels, renewable energy is derived from naturally replenishing resources that are abundant and sustainable. Let’s explore the incredible potential and benefits of harnessing renewable energy sources.

Solar Energy

Solar energy, obtained from the sun’s rays, is one of the most abundant sources of renewable energy. Solar panels convert sunlight into electricity, offering a clean and efficient way to power homes, businesses, and even entire communities. With advancements in technology, solar power has become more affordable and accessible than ever before.

Wind Energy

Wind energy harnesses the power of wind to generate electricity through wind turbines. Wind farms can be found on land and offshore, capturing the kinetic energy of the wind to produce clean and sustainable power. Wind energy is a rapidly growing sector in the renewable energy industry, offering a reliable source of electricity with minimal environmental impact.

Hydroelectric Power

Hydroelectric power utilizes flowing water to generate electricity through turbines in dams or river systems. This form of renewable energy is highly efficient and has been used for decades to produce clean electricity for homes and industries. Hydroelectric power plants provide a reliable source of energy while reducing greenhouse gas emissions.

Geothermal Energy

Geothermal energy taps into the heat stored beneath the Earth’s surface to generate electricity or heat buildings directly. Geothermal power plants use steam or hot water reservoirs to drive turbines and produce clean, sustainable energy. This renewable energy source is reliable, cost-effective, and environmentally friendly.

Biomass Energy

Biomass energy derives from organic materials such as wood waste, agricultural residues, or even landfill gas. By converting biomass into biofuels or biogas, we can create renewable sources of heat and electricity while reducing waste and carbon emissions. Biomass energy offers a versatile solution for sustainable energy production.

In conclusion, renewable sources of energy offer a promising path towards a cleaner, more sustainable future. By investing in renewable energy technologies and transitioning away from fossil fuels, we can reduce our carbon footprint, combat climate change, and secure a greener planet for future generations.

Consider investing in hydrogen fuel cells as a clean and renewable energy source.

When exploring renewable energy options, it is worth considering investing in hydrogen fuel cells as a clean and sustainable energy source. Hydrogen fuel cells produce electricity through a chemical reaction between hydrogen and oxygen, emitting only water vapor as a byproduct. This technology offers an efficient and environmentally friendly way to power vehicles, buildings, and even entire energy grids. By embracing hydrogen fuel cells, we can reduce our reliance on fossil fuels, lower carbon emissions, and pave the way for a more sustainable energy future.

Regularly clean solar panels to ensure optimal energy production.

Regularly cleaning solar panels is essential to ensure optimal energy production from this renewable energy source. Dust, dirt, and debris can accumulate on the surface of solar panels, reducing their efficiency in converting sunlight into electricity. By maintaining clean solar panels, you can maximize their performance and output, allowing for greater energy generation and a more sustainable use of solar power. Scheduled cleaning and maintenance of solar panels not only improve their longevity but also contribute to a more efficient utilization of this clean and renewable energy resource.

Explore offshore wind farms as a sustainable option for wind energy.

Exploring offshore wind farms presents a sustainable option for harnessing wind energy. By setting up wind turbines in offshore locations, we can take advantage of stronger and more consistent winds, leading to increased energy production. Offshore wind farms not only help diversify our renewable energy sources but also have the potential to reduce land use conflicts and visual impacts associated with onshore wind projects. Investing in offshore wind energy is a promising step towards achieving a greener and more sustainable future.

Monitor wind patterns to maximize the output of wind turbines.

Monitoring wind patterns is crucial to optimizing the efficiency and output of wind turbines, a key component of harnessing wind energy. By carefully tracking and analyzing wind speeds and directions, operators can adjust the positioning of turbines to capture the maximum amount of kinetic energy from the wind. This proactive approach ensures that wind farms operate at peak performance levels, maximizing electricity generation from this renewable energy source.
